Key responsibilities
Confidently use Canva to design and produce a wide range of marketing and publicity materials, ensuring all content is accurate, high quality and consistent with hospice brand guidelines and corporate identity.
Use Mailchimp to create, build and distribute email communications for external audiences, staff and volunteers.
Receive training in, and use, the hospice's CRM and donor management system (Beacon) to record relevant interactions and maintain accurate records in accordance with GDPR and organisational procedures.
Monitor and report on marketing activity, assisting with the production of monthly and quarterly performance reports using agreed key performance indicators to evaluate campaign effectiveness and inform future activity.
Ensure all marketing and communications activities reflect the values, mission and strategic objectives of the hospice.

Digital marketing
Create engaging daily content for the hospice's social media channels, including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, X and TikTok .
Confidently u se social media scheduling platform, Buffer for content planning and scheduling .
Confidently monitor and reply to comments and messages across social media platforms and escalate where appropriate/ if needed.
Plan, create, film and edit video content for use across digital channels, including social media and the hospice website.
• Monitor the performance of digital marketing activity .
C ontribute to the evaluation of campaigns to inform future communications strategies.
